A delicacy with a thousand-year history will be presented by the Lipetsk region on the Day of the Region at the RUSSIA EXPO.

The Gingerbread Festival will present gingerbread according to author’s recipes from famous gingerbread masters of the region. Masterclasses, gingerbread tasting and tea drinking from samovar are waiting for the guests.

ZADONSKY GINGERBREAD. Handmade gingerbread dough is filled with Zadonsky honey, a mixture of spices and seasonings — cinnamon, nutmeg, ginger, star anise, allspice and black pepper. The mixtures are made and ground in a bakery. For the filling they take the famous jam from Belyov in the Tula region, renowned for its pastila. Sergey Putilin, the founder of the "Zadonsky Krai" bakery, will present a specialty Zadonsky gingerbread.

DANKOVSKY GINGERBREAD according to the author’s recipe is made by custard method with carefully selected spices and Jerusalem artichoke syrup. The product will be presented by gingerbread master Natalia Alferova, bakery technologist and confectioner.

LIMAK — the aroma of these gingerbreads is familiar to everyone who visits the center of Lipetsk. Here, at the Lipetsk bakery, soft gingerbread for your tea party is baked — with apple and cranberry filling, mint, chocolate. Yulia Myakotnykh, manager of the Argamach Nature Park (Yeletsky district), will present LIMAK gingerbread.
